Genetical-Breeding Improvement of Flax in Russia

Domestic flax breeding programs have developed 26 of the 35 flax cultivars grown in Russia. Intraspecies hybridization has enlarged the genetic pool for fiber and seed yield selection, lodging resistance, and resistance to fusarium and other flax diseases. The recently developed flax varieties A-29, A-93, alexim, Krom, Lenok, and T-16 have fiber yields of 2,500-2,800 kilograms per hectare. Some cultivars have fiber content of over 40 percent in the plant stem. Induced recombinogenesis and metagenesis improve flax fiber quality, vegetation period, yield control, and quality control. Pollen breeding methods could alter segregation in the next generation of flax plants and improve drought resistance and wilt resistance.
